OpenInference Instrumentation for BeeAI

This module provides automatic instrumentation for BeeAI framework. It integrates seamlessly with the @opentelemetry/sdk-trace-node to collect and export telemetry data.

Installation

pip install openinference-instrumentation-beeai

Quickstart

This quickstart shows you how to instrument your guardrailed LLM application

Install required packages.

pip install beeai-framework arize-phoenix opentelemetry-sdk opentelemetry-exporter-otlp

Start Phoenix in the background as a collector. By default, it listens on http://localhost:6006. You can visit the app via a browser at the same address. (Phoenix does not send data over the internet. It only operates locally on your machine.)

python -m phoenix.server.main serve

Set up BeeAIInstrumentor to trace your crew and send the traces to Phoenix at the endpoint defined below. The openinference_setup.py file.

import logging

from opentelemetry import trace as trace_api
from opentelemetry.exporter.otlp.proto.http.trace_exporter import OTLPSpanExporter
from opentelemetry.sdk import trace as trace_sdk
from opentelemetry.sdk.resources import Resource
from opentelemetry.sdk.trace.export import ConsoleSpanExporter, SimpleSpanProcessor

from openinference.instrumentation.beeai import BeeAIInstrumentor

logging.basicConfig(level=logging.DEBUG)


def setup_observability(endpoint: str = "http://localhost:6006/v1/traces") -> None:
    """
    Sets up OpenTelemetry with OTLP HTTP exporter and instruments the beeai framework.
    """
    resource = Resource(attributes={})
    tracer_provider = trace_sdk.TracerProvider(resource=resource)
    tracer_provider.add_span_processor(SimpleSpanProcessor(OTLPSpanExporter(endpoint)))
    tracer_provider.add_span_processor(SimpleSpanProcessor(ConsoleSpanExporter()))
    trace_api.set_tracer_provider(tracer_provider)

    BeeAIInstrumentor().instrument()

Set up a simple ReActAgent to get the current weather in Las Vegas.

import asyncio
import sys
import traceback

from beeai_framework.agents.react import ReActAgent
from beeai_framework.agents.types import AgentExecutionConfig
from beeai_framework.backend.chat import ChatModel
from beeai_framework.backend.types import ChatModelParameters
from beeai_framework.errors import FrameworkError
from beeai_framework.memory import TokenMemory
from beeai_framework.tools.search import DuckDuckGoSearchTool, WikipediaTool
from beeai_framework.tools.tool import AnyTool
from beeai_framework.tools.weather.openmeteo import OpenMeteoTool
from openinference_setup import setup_observability

setup_observability()

llm = ChatModel.from_name(
    "ollama:granite3.1-dense:8b",
    ChatModelParameters(temperature=0),
)

tools: list[AnyTool] = [
    WikipediaTool(),
    OpenMeteoTool(),
    DuckDuckGoSearchTool(),
]

agent = ReActAgent(llm=llm, tools=tools, memory=TokenMemory(llm))

prompt = "What's the current weather in Las Vegas?"


async def main() -> None:
    response = await agent.run(
        prompt=prompt,
        execution=AgentExecutionConfig(
            max_retries_per_step=3, total_max_retries=10, max_iterations=20
        ),
    )

    print("Agent 🤖 : ", response.result.text)


if __name__ == "__main__":
    try:
        asyncio.run(main())
    except FrameworkError as e:
        traceback.print_exc()
        sys.exit(e.explain())
